About the Manafossen to Oygardstol trail
Manafossen to Oygardstol (Norway) is a 21.3-mile point-to-point route with 4,443 feet of gain. Elevation ranges from 458 feet to 3,237 feet. The steepest pitch reaches 118 percent, against an average of 209 feet of gain per mile. On our gain-and-distance scale it falls in the very strenuous band. The nearest town is Jørpeland, 17 miles away.
The trail
Månafossen is a waterfall in Gjesdal Municipality in Rogaland county, Norway. The 92 metre tall waterfall is located along the river Månaåna, about 6 kilometres east of the end of the Frafjorden where the village of Frafjord is located.
